Dario Slaps £25k Price Tag On Zola

Dario wants £25,000 for want-away striker Calvin Zola.. according to the Daily Mail.

Dario has already confirmed that any club wanting to sign Zola, who is only willing to leave Gresty Road on a permanent basis, will have to cough up some cash.

Bradford, Southend, Burton and Shrewsbury have already ruled out a permanent deal for Zola whilst Northampton are mulling it over.

£25,000 would probably be a fair deal considering Zola's current contract expires at the end of the season though you can't help but wonder if we managed to get £175k worth out of Calvin...

Then there is the matter of finding someone to pay the £25k fee. Plenty are lining up to take Zola on loan but all make a quick u-turn upon hearing Zola's fee and wage demands. In this climate, in this division there are only the odd couple of clubs with the money to spare, nevermind the clubs willing to spend it.
